How they compare

Viet Nam currently reports 19.0% against 18.5% in Nigeria, a difference of 0.5%.

The two have swapped places 8 times across 26 shared years of data; in 1996 it was Viet Nam ahead.

Nigeria ranks 29th and Viet Nam ranks 27th of 159 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, Nigeria averaged higher in 2 and Viet Nam in 2.

Head to head by decade

Decade Nigeria Viet Nam Difference Ahead
1990s 18.3% 16.8% 1.6% Nigeria
2000s 15.3% 13.9% 1.4% Nigeria
2010s 6.1% 17.9% 11.8% Viet Nam
2020s 16.4% 19.5% 3.0% Viet Nam

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

Adjusted net savings are equal to net national savings plus education expenditure and minus energy depletion, mineral depletion, net forest depletion, and carbon dioxide and particulate emissions damage. This indicator is expressed as a percentage of Gross National Income (GNI) which is the total income earned by all residents within an economic territory during an accounting period. It is equal to gross domestic product plus earned income receivable from abroad minus earned income payable abroad.
